Recovery time for a broken foot depends on the extent of the injury. If the injury is mild, after active treatment and proper care, it can be healed in 2 to 3 weeks, and if it is serious, such as causing a fracture, it usually takes about 3 months. After a broken foot, you should rest and brake immediately, and actively improve the relevant imaging tests to determine the extent of soft tissue damage. If the degree of injury is mild, you can apply ice packs to the injured area within 72 hours, and heat packs after 72 hours. When there is pain phenomenon can also be taken orally non-steroidal anti-inflammatory drugs such as ibuprofen, celecoxib and other anti-inflammatory pain, such patients after active treatment generally 2 to 3 weeks can be healed. If the degree of injury is more serious, there is a fracture and ligament damage, we should consult a doctor in time, under the guidance of the doctor to the fracture part of the reset, there are surgical indications, we should actively carry out surgical treatment. After surgery, targeted care should be carried out. It usually takes about 3 months to heal with proper care. The above medications should be taken under the guidance of a medical professional.
